Output 643026b9562233357c16c98d70dc6cbfdb481da03b2e9c6b86fe3af887148e8a:0

value
60121268
script pubkey
OP_0 OP_PUSHBYTES_20 bfd6708ec96f0c3c4796908347a887b1d13d1882
address
ltc1qhlt8prkfduxrc3ukjzp502y8k8gn6xyzttd449
transaction
643026b9562233357c16c98d70dc6cbfdb481da03b2e9c6b86fe3af887148e8a
spent
true